New Century Cities: Real Estate Value in a Digital World

New Century Cities is a joint research initiative between MIT�s Center for Real Estate, City Design and Development (Urban Studies and Planning), and the Media Lab�s Smart Cities group. It focuses on a new generation of development projects. These ambitious initiatives are emerging at the intersection of social policy, technology, urban design, and real estate development, and are located in what we call New Century Cities (NCCs). You will find them today in New York City; Cambridge, Massachusetts; Belfast; Helsinki; Copenhagen; Seoul; and Singapore. In addition, NCC projects are on the drawing boards in places such as Florianopolis, Brazil and Zaragoza, Spain. These projects vary in size and in how their development is organized and led. The research initiative focuses on developing a profile of these projects, creating development guidelines, and collecting case studies of technologies that fulfill these visions for future urban spaces.
